Twelve tales from the dark side of the Russian imagination.

The dead who will not stay buried. A portrait whose painted eyes will not close. A village where, after dark, the living belong to the vourdalak. For a hundred years the great Russian writers returned to one threshold - the one between the living and the dead - and brought back some of the most unsettling fiction ever set down.

Russian Ghost Stories gathers twelve of those tales in new English translations, arranged in four movements. Pushkin's gambler hunts a secret worth a life. Gogol's seminarian keeps watch over a coffin that does not stay shut. Dostoevsky stoops to the chatter of the graveyard. Chekhov watches a brilliant man courted by a black monk who may be madness or may be grace. Andreyev follows Lazarus back out of the tomb and asks what a man carries home from the grave.
